在CentOS系统中,分区的高级功能主要包括以下几个方面:
-
LVM(逻辑卷管理):
- 动态扩容:LVM允许用户动态地调整逻辑卷的大小,无需停机或重新分区。例如,可以通过
lvextend
命令扩展逻辑卷的大小。 - 快照和镜像:LVM支持创建逻辑卷的快照和镜像,提高了数据的安全性和可靠性。
- 动态扩容:LVM允许用户动态地调整逻辑卷的大小,无需停机或重新分区。例如,可以通过
-
Btrfs文件系统:
- 跨物理设备创建文件系统:Btrfs允许将多个硬盘或分区合并为一个单一的、连续的存储空间。
- 写时复制(COW):确保数据在修改过程中的安全性。
- 数据和元数据的校验机制:提高了数据的准确性和可靠性。
- 子卷和快照:支持将一个大的文件系统划分为多个独立的部分,并创建文件系统的副本。
-
高级分区方案:
- 根据服务器用途分配不同的分区大小,如
/usr
、/var
等分区,适用于需要大量应用程序和数据的服务器。
- 根据服务器用途分配不同的分区大小,如
-
分区管理工具:
- fdisk和parted:这些是功能强大的命令行工具,支持MBR和GPT分区表,适用于有一定经验的用户进行磁盘管理。
-
自动化挂载:
- 使用Ansible或其他自动化工具来简化挂载配置的过程。
-
监控和性能调优:
- 使用磁盘监控工具(如
df
、du
、iostat
等)定期检查磁盘空间使用情况,及时发现并解决存储空间不足的问题。
- 使用磁盘监控工具(如
在进行这些高级分区操作时,建议务必备份重要数据,以防数据丢失。同时,根据实际的业务需求、硬件配置以及预期的负载和管理需求来确定合适的分区方案。